Rotary serves up Easter fun at park

Annual event features breakfast, egg hunt and plenty of activities

The Rotary Club of Tsawwassen hosted its annual pancake breakfast and Easter egg hunt at Diefenbaker Park last Saturday morning.

Over 1,800 pancakes and 1,600 sausages were served over the course of the morning, according to event coordinator Leslie Abramson.

There were also a variety of activities for the children, including pony rides, a petting zoo, face painting, balloon twist, cookie decorating and a bouncy castle. Midway through the event the children were greeted by the Easter Bunny who hopped by to start the egg hunt where over 10,000 chocolate eggs were up for grabs.

"To see the excitement on the kids'faces, and the joy it gave to the parents, made this event well worth it," says Abramson.
